IDF Strikes Hamas Company Commander Planning Attacks in Khan Younis

The IDF said it carried out an airstrike on a company commander in Hamas's military wing in Khan Younis after intelligence indicated he was planning attacks against Israeli troops in Gaza. The military said the operation was conducted to remove an immediate threat to forces deployed in the area. It did not identify the commander or announce the outcome of the strike in its initial statement. The IDF said Southern Command troops remain positioned in accordance with the current agreement and will continue acting against immediate threats to Israeli forces.
